* Create fimrware/asm directory for assembly optimized stuff.Thomas Martitz2012-01-22
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| This dir is suitable for stuff that doesn't fit the target tree, e.g. because it also builds on hosted or otherwise. It also has a generic subfolder for fallback C implementations so that not all archs need to provide asm files. SOURCES should only contain "foo.c" where foo.c includes the specific <arch>/foo.c files from the subdirs using the preprocessor. This way automatic selection of asm versions or generic C verion is possible. For the start, the thread support files are moved, since ASM threads can be used on hosted platforms as well. Since core_sleep() remains platform specific it's moved to the corresponding system.h headers. Change-Id: Iebff272f3407a6eaafeb7656ceb0ae9eca3f7cb9

* FS#11335 by me: make ARM assembly functions thumb-friendlyRafaël Carré2010-06-11
| | | | | | | | | | | | | We can't pop into pc on ARMv4t when using thumb: the T bit won't be modified if we are returning to a thumb function Code running on ARMv4t should use the new ldrpc / ldmpc macros instead of ldr pc, [sp], #4 and ldm(cond) sp!, {regs, pc} No modification on pure ARM builds and ARMv5+ Note: USE_THUMB is currently never defined, no targets can currently be built with -mthumb, see FS#6734 git-svn-id: svn://svn.rockbox.org/rockbox/trunk@26756 a1c6a512-1295-4272-9138-f99709370657
